Five Rows 2007 Pinot Noir
Five Rows Vineyard began in 1984 with the planting of, you guessed it, 5 rows of Pinot Noir; today they are up to 20 rows of Pinot Noir alone and their wines come from their own rows of fruit. The nose is earthy with sour cherry, raspberry, cranberry and some cinnamon-spice. The palate is sour cherry with red berries, cranberry tartness, and hints of spice along with a good balance of acidity and tannins. The wine is aged in nothing but new French oak and only 2 barrels were produced – or only 1188 bottles. Price: $50.00 – Rating: ****½
